Output f4fedaf128afae41ae5f109992de7ab4cb1e8fc797b98bd9ba2881c17a54e27c:1

value
34035341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 418fd6a339dfabb33fde453f7bc4629e839cb1eb OP_EQUAL
address
MDspTy7pFvYLi4AvoBbe9uLz81gQfSnAGw
transaction
f4fedaf128afae41ae5f109992de7ab4cb1e8fc797b98bd9ba2881c17a54e27c
spent
true